Valon Fazliu (born 2 February 1996) is a Swiss professional footballer who plays as a forward for the Swiss club FC Lugano.

Professional career

A youth product of the Grasshopper youth academy, Fazliu signed his first professional contract on 9 August 2017 for 3 years.[2] Fazliu made his professional debut for Grasshopper in a 1-0 Swiss Super League loss to FC Sion on 19 February 2018.[3]

In his debut season, Fazliu was loaned to Rapperswil-Jona and scored 7 goals in 23 games. On 21 July 2018, he signed with FC Lugano keeping him at the club until 2022.[4]

Personal life

Born in Switzerland, Fazliu is of Kosovan descent and also holds a Serbian passport.[5]
